The match between Cagliari and Juventus will take place at the Unipol Domus at 16:45 (BRT). Juventus is positioned fourth in the league with 46 points, aiming to solidify their place for Champions League qualification. Meanwhile, Cagliari sits at 14th place with 25 points, needing to secure points to distance themselves from the relegation zone. Juventus has displayed strong form against Cagliari, remaining unbeaten for the last eight encounters. The last time Cagliari triumphed over Juve was back in 2020. On the other hand, Cagliari is recovering from mixed results, struggling lately but hoping for a positive outcome to alleviate relegation fears.

The match played at the Giuseppe Meazza was tightly contested. Inter edged out Genoa 1-0 thanks to Lautaro Martínez's header. The game was characterized by Inter’s struggles against Genoa’s pressing game, particularly during the first half when they failed to create clear chances. It was Martinez’s goal from a corner kick late in the second half which finally broke the deadlock, securing Inter's lead at the top of the table with 57 points.
